HDPE (High-Density Polyethylene)

A dense, highly linear, crystalline form of polyethylene known for stiffness, a crinkly feel, and strong moisture barrier properties in film.

HDPE is produced with very little branching along its polymer backbone, typically through Ziegler-Natta or chromium-based catalysts, which lets the molecular chains pack tightly together. That tight packing produces a density generally between 0.941 and 0.965 grams per cubic centimeter and a much higher degree of crystallinity than LDPE or LLDPE. In film form, this translates into a stiffer, less stretchy material with a distinctive crinkly or papery hand feel that most people recognize from grocery store t-shirt bags.

HDPE film offers excellent moisture barrier and good stiffness at very low gauges, which makes it economical for high-volume, lightweight applications like retail merchandise bags, bread bags, and some liner applications where rigidity rather than stretch is desired. Its higher crystallinity also tends to produce more haze and lower clarity than LLDPE or LDPE, and its lower elongation makes it more prone to tearing rather than stretching under stress, so it's rarely used alone where puncture resistance is the top priority.

In blown film, HDPE is often run at very thin gauges, sometimes under one mil, since its stiffness allows a usable bag to be made with very little material, which is part of why it remains a cost-efficient choice in high-volume retail and grocery bag production.

Example

The crinkly, slightly rattly bag handed out at a retail checkout counter is almost always HDPE, chosen because it lets the bag manufacturer use very little resin per bag while still getting a serviceable, stiff carrying bag.

Nuance

It is a common misconception that HDPE is simply a stronger, more durable version of LDPE or LLDPE because the name implies higher density equals higher quality. In film applications, HDPE actually has lower elongation and puncture resistance than LLDPE; its advantage is stiffness and moisture barrier at minimal gauge, not overall toughness.
